4-Nitrophenyl 2,3,4-Tri-O-acetyl-6-O-trityl-α-D-glucopyranoside is a versatile compound extensively utilized in carbohydrate chemistry and glycobiology research. Its chemical structure comprises a trityl-protected glucosyl moiety, offering stability and facilitating selective deprotection reactions. This compound serves as a building block for synthesizing complex oligosaccharides and glycoconjugates due to its ability to undergo regioselective and stereoselective glycosylation reactions. The trityl group shields the hydroxyl functionalities, enabling precise control over glycosylation reactions and protecting labile glycosidic linkages during synthetic transformations. Additionally, 4-Nitrophenyl 2,3,4-Tri-O-acetyl-6-O-trityl-α-D-glucopyranoside is employed as a substrate in enzymatic assays to study the activity and specificity of glycosidases and glycosyltransferases. The nitrophenyl leaving group facilitates detection of enzymatic hydrolysis, allowing quantitative analysis of enzyme kinetics and substrate specificity. Furthermore, this compound is utilized in the synthesis of glycoconjugates, glycopeptides, and glycolipids for applications in chemical biology, bioorganic chemistry, and drug discovery. Overall, 4-Nitrophenyl 2,3,4-Tri-O-acetyl-6-O-trityl-α-D-glucopyranoside plays a pivotal role in advancing our understanding of carbohydrate biochemistry and is instrumental in the development of novel glycotherapeutics and biomaterials.
